Comprehending Color Psychology and Its Effect On Organization



When you select colors for your business's exterior, understanding color psychology can substantially affect just how prospective consumers view your brand.



Colors stimulate feelings and established the tone for your business. For instance, blue typically shares depend on and professionalism and reliability, making it suitable for financial institutions. Red can develop a sense of necessity, ideal for restaurants and clearance sales.

On the other hand, environment-friendly symbolizes growth and sustainability, attracting eco-conscious consumers. Yellow grabs attention and stimulates positive outlook, but too much can bewilder.

Tips for Balancing With the Surrounding Atmosphere



To create a natural appearance that blends seamlessly with your surroundings, take into consideration the natural environment and building styles nearby. Begin by observing the colors of nearby structures and landscapes. Natural tones like eco-friendlies, browns, and muted grays commonly function well in all-natural setups.

Next, think about the architectural style of your structure. Traditional styles may take advantage of timeless colors, while modern styles can accept modern schemes.

Evaluate your color options with samples on the wall surface to see exactly how they communicate with the light and atmosphere.

Lastly, bear in mind any type of regional standards or community appearances to ensure your selection improves, instead of clashes with, the environments.
